The Evolution of the Reels
It is wild to think about how far we have come from the humble beginnings of the industry. The first slot machines paid out in coins, cigars or drinks, which was a clever way to keep people on the premises without handing out actual cash. Those machines were mechanical beasts, reliant on gears and levers rather than code and screens. Today, the graphics are immersive, and the themes are as varied as the items in a supermarket aisle, but the core thrill remains the same.
Technology has turned the slot machine into a digital experience that can be accessed from anywhere with an internet connection. Responsible Gaming and Data Analytics
The industry has a responsibility to look out for its patrons, and technology plays a big role in that safeguarding process. Data analytics let operators identify potential problem gamblers from their betting patterns. This is a crucial development, as it allows for early intervention before things spiral out of control. By monitoring how often a player logs in, how much they spend, and the duration of their sessions, algorithms can flag behaviour that suggests risky habits.
This is not about spying on players for the sake of it; it is about offering help when it is needed. Operators can reach out with resources or even set limits on accounts that show signs of trouble. It is a proactive approach that acknowledges the risks associated with gambling while still providing the entertainment. The goal is to keep the fun in the game and remove the harm that can come from unchecked spending or obsessive behaviour.
